The Origins of Black Widow

Black Widow’s real name is Natasha Romanoff. She was trained in the secretive Red Room, a Soviet program designed to turn young girls into elite spies and assassins. The training was intense and ruthless, shaping Natasha into one of the most dangerous operatives in the world.

However, Natasha eventually chose a different path. Seeking redemption for her past actions, she defected and began working with S.H.I.E.L.D., where she used her skills to protect the world rather than harm it.

A Key Member of the Avengers

Black Widow became a founding member of the Avengers, working alongside iconic heroes like Iron Man, Captain America, and Thor. Despite not having superpowers, she consistently proves herself as one of the team’s most reliable operatives.

Her specialties include:

• Master-level martial arts

• Expert espionage and infiltration

• Advanced tactical intelligence

• Skilled marksmanship

Black Widow often serves as the team’s strategist, gathering critical intelligence before missions begin.

The Black Widow Film

In 2021, Black Widow finally received her own standalone movie, Black Widow, starring Scarlett Johansson. The film explores Natasha’s past and introduces her complicated relationship with her surrogate family, including Yelena Belova.

The movie dives deeper into Natasha’s life before the events of Avengers: Infinity War and Avengers: Endgame, giving fans a better understanding of the sacrifices she made throughout her journey.
